Table of Telecommunication Optical Cable Laying Cost Standards

Fiber optic cable laying costs vary widely based on installation method, fiber type, trenching depth, and regional labor rates, typically ranging from $2.50 to $50 per foot depending on conditions.Cost Overview by Installation TypeCost ComponentUnderground DeploymentAerial DeploymentNotes / Influencing FactorsFiber Cable Material$1.00 – $6.00 per foot$1.00 – $6.00 per footSingle-mode fiber is generally cheaper than multimode; higher strand counts increase cost; armored or plenum-rated cables cost more Conduit / Duct$0.60 – $2.20 per footOften not required if using existing polesCosts vary with trenching depth, conduit type, and local regulations Trenching / Excavation$14.50 – $26.50 per footN/APlowing is cheaper; trenching in rocky or urban areas increases cost; includes backfill and restoration Aerial InstallationN/A$4.90 – $7.00 per footCosts depend on pole ownership (own vs rented) and cabling method (Strand, Lash, ADSS), Labor$13 – $26 per foot$4 – $7 per footLabor accounts for 60–80% of total cost; internal labor is cheaper than outsourced Permitting / Regulatory FeesVariableVariableUrban areas and complex permits increase total project cost Total Project Cost (per mile)$5,000 – $80,000$2,500 – $40,000Depends on project complexity, distance, and environmental factors Key Cost DriversInstallation Method: Underground trenching is 20–40% more expensive than aerial deployment due to labor and equipment needs .Fiber Type and Count: Single-mode fiber is cheaper per foot than multimode, but multimode may be preferred for shorter distances or higher bandwidth requirements .Distance and Terrain: Longer runs, rocky soil, or urban obstacles increase labor and equipment costs .Permitting and Local Regulations: Urban areas with complex permitting can significantly raise costs .Labor Rates: Skilled fiber technicians typically charge $50–$150 per hour, influencing total deployment cost .Per-Unit Cost SummaryFiber Cable: $1–$6 per foot depending on type and strand count Conduit / Duct: $0.60–$2.20 per foot Trenching: $14.50–$26.50 per foot Aerial Installation: $4.90–$7.00 per foot Labor: $13 per foot (underground) / $4 per foot (aerial) median Practical NotesAerial deployment is cost-effective where poles are available and permits are simpler.Bundling services and using existing infrastructure can reduce costs.Urban projects with complex permitting, blasting, or restoration requirements can reach the higher end of the cost spectrum.Project planning should consider fiber lifespan (20–30 years), maintenance, and potential future upgrades . This table and summary provide a practical standard reference for budgeting and planning fiber optic cable deployment projects, reflecting current U.S. market conditions and installation practices.
